2007 Men's Lacrosse

43 Nick Jackson

  • Height 6-1
  • Weight 188
  • Year Senior
  • Hometown Silver Spring, Md.
  • High School St. John's College
  • Position DEF

Biography

2007:  Named Second Team All-MAAC on defense...Scored a goal in the Mount's 9-6 win over Wagner on Senior Day...Picked up a season-high five ground balls against Siena...Tallied 18 ground balls on the year...Finished career with 77 ground balls.

2006: Started 14 of 16 games for the Mount as long stick midfielder...Had 20 ground balls on the year...Picked up a ground ball in 12 of 16 games on the season...Grabbed season-high three ground balls in home win over VMI.

2005: Was the Mount's top long stick midfielder...Appeared in all 17 games, tallying two goals and 38 ground balls on the year...Scored at #2 Duke and at home vs. Marist...Had career-best six ground balls in home win over Wagner...Had four ground balls at home vs. Robert Morris and at Canisius...Had six games with three or more ground balls.

2004: Played in two games off the bench for the Mount...Made collegiate debut vs. nationally ranked Towson...Also played at #5 Georgetown, picking up a ground ball in that game.

HIGH SCHOOL: A three-year member of the lacrosse team at St. John's College (HS) in Washington, D.C....Named Second Team All-WCAC as a senior after earning Third Team honors as a sophomore...A member of the honor roll as a junior and senior.
